Remarks | The time I put was approximate, but probably with 1/2 hour of the time I listed. I have a cataract in one eye, so the specirfic size of it may have been blurred. We have foothills close to the house and it disaperred as it went behind them. It was pretty...seemed smooth. It lasted longer and was brighter than I have seen in what i think are falling stars. |
